Celiac Disease Bulk Plasma for Autoimmune and Gluten-Related Disease Research
Celiac Disease Bulk Plasma is collected from IRB-consented donors diagnosed with celiac disease using apheresis, with ACDA (Acid-Citrate-Dextrose Formula A) as the anticoagulant. Celiac disease is an autoimmune enteropathy in which dietary gluten peptides, presented in the context of HLA-DQ2 or HLA-DQ8, drive a T cell-mediated response against the small intestinal mucosa together with characteristic autoantibody production against tissue transglutaminase. Gluten-Driven Autoimmunity and Why Bulk Plasma
- Celiac disease is genuinely autoimmune: the hallmark serological finding is IgA autoantibody against tissue transglutaminase 2 (tTG), accompanied in many patients by anti-endomysial and deamidated gliadin peptide antibodies.
- Susceptibility is tightly restricted by HLA class II. Nearly all patients carry HLA-DQ2 or HLA-DQ8, which present deamidated gluten peptides to CD4+ T cells and initiate the mucosal immune response.
- Gluten exposure and gluten-free dietary adherence directly modulate autoantibody titre, making treatment and diet status a critical variable when selecting donors.
- Bulk apheresis plasma yields the litre-scale volumes needed for antibody purification, reference and calibrator panel manufacture, and repeated-use control material — work that single-donor tubes cannot support.
- ACDA anticoagulation and apheresis collection give a consistent, high-volume matrix suited to immunoassay development and to proteomic and metabolomic discovery.
- Plasma is acellular. It supports autoantibody quantification, cytokine and mucosal damage marker immunoassay and multi-omic profiling, but not cell-based or immunophenotyping assays.
